A dog stolen while accompanying his owners on their world travels has finally been reunited with his family after more than three months apart.Luke was stolen from his owners, Janin Scharrenberg and Steffen Kagerah, at Marina Beach in Chennai, India, in July. A Facebook post by animal welfare worker Shravan Krishnan read that the dog had been found with a teenager on a beach in October, and was microchip-checked to reveal he was the missing Luke.Krishnan also shared video of the moment Luke was reunited with his owners. In the video, Luke began to whimper when he realised who the people in front of him were and Scharrenberg broke into tears. The video had over 44,000 views at time of writing.
